Career path

Career Role Description
Health Data Scientist (UK) Develops and implements advanced statistical models to analyze large health datasets. Strong programming (Python, R) and machine learning skills are essential. High demand in NHS and private healthcare.
Biostatistician (UK) Applies statistical methods to analyze biological data, specifically within the healthcare context. Expertise in clinical trials and epidemiological studies is highly valued.
Data Analyst - Healthcare (UK) Extracts, cleans, and transforms health data to provide insights for improved healthcare delivery. SQL and data visualization skills are critical. Growing job market across various sectors.
Health Informatics Specialist (UK) Focuses on the design, implementation, and management of health information systems. Understanding of data governance and healthcare regulations is paramount.
